军浩软件日志,一家优质百科知识收集与分享的网站

MySQL数据库怎么打开?小白必看,手把手教你正确姿势,拯救你的数据库焦虑!

MySQL数据库怎么打开?小白必看,手把手教你正确姿势,拯救你的数据库焦虑!

数据库作为数据存储的核心,对于开发者来说至关重要。但是,当你面对MySQL数据库时,是否感到无从下手? 不知道如何打开和管理MySQL数据库?别担心,这篇文章将手把手教你如何轻松打开和管理MySQL数据库,无论是通过命令行还是图形界面工具,都能让你轻松上手,建议收藏!

一、MySQL数据库简介,了解它是谁?

在开始之前,让我们先来了解一下MySQL数据库是什么。 MySQL是一个关系型数据库管理系统,由瑞典MySQL AB公司开发,目前属于Oracle公司。它是最流行的开源数据库之一,广泛应用于Web应用、企业级应用等领域。


MySQL的特点包括:
1. 开源免费:MySQL是开源软件,可以免费使用。
2. 高性能:MySQL在处理大量数据时表现出色,支持高并发访问。
3. 跨平台:MySQL可以在多种操作系统上运行,如Windows、Linux、Mac OS等。
4. 易于使用:MySQL提供了丰富的API和工具,使得数据库管理和操作变得简单。
5. 社区支持:MySQL拥有庞大的用户社区,遇到问题时可以轻松找到解决方案。

二、如何通过命令行打开MySQL数据库?

对于初学者来说,通过命令行打开MySQL数据库可能有些陌生,但其实非常简单。 下面我们就来一步步操作:


1. 启动MySQL服务:
在打开MySQL数据库之前,确保MySQL服务已经启动。你可以通过以下命令检查服务状态(以Windows为例):
net start mysql
如果服务未启动,可以使用以下命令启动:
net start mysql


2. 登录MySQL:
打开命令行窗口(Windows下按Win+R键,输入cmd,回车),输入以下命令登录MySQL:
mysql -u root -p
其中,-u root表示以root用户身份登录,-p表示需要输入密码。输入密码后,如果成功登录,你会看到MySQL的提示符:
mysql>


3. 选择数据库:
登录成功后,你需要选择要操作的数据库。假设你要操作的数据库名为testdb,可以使用以下命令:
use testdb;
成功选择数据库后,你会看到如下提示:
Database changed


4. 执行SQL命令:
选择数据库后,你就可以执行各种SQL命令了,比如查询表数据:
SELECT FROM users;
或者插入数据:
INSERT INTO users (name, email) VALUES ('Alice', 'alice@example.com');

三、如何通过图形界面工具打开MySQL数据库?

虽然命令行操作灵活强大,但对于初学者来说,图形界面工具更加友好。 下面介绍两款常用的MySQL图形界面工具:phpMyAdmin和MySQL Workbench。


1. 使用phpMyAdmin

phpMyAdmin是一个基于Web的MySQL数据库管理工具,可以通过浏览器访问。 安装和配置phpMyAdmin的方法有很多,这里以XAMPP为例:


1. 安装XAMPP:
访问XAMPP官网下载并安装XAMPP,安装过程中选择安装phpMyAdmin。
2. 启动Apache和MySQL服务:
打开XAMPP控制面板,启动Apache和MySQL服务。
3. 访问phpMyAdmin:
打开浏览器,输入http://localhost/phpmyadmin,进入phpMyAdmin的登录页面,使用MySQL的用户名和密码登录即可。


2. 使用MySQL Workbench

MySQL Workbench是MySQL官方提供的图形化数据库管理工具,功能强大且易用。 下载和安装MySQL Workbench的方法如下:


1. 下载MySQL Workbench:
访问MySQL官网下载MySQL Workbench,根据你的操作系统选择合适的版本。
2. 安装MySQL Workbench:
下载完成后,双击安装包按照提示完成安装。
3. 连接MySQL数据库:
打开MySQL Workbench,点击“Database”菜单中的“Manage Connections”,添加一个新的连接,填写主机名、端口、用户名和密码,点击“Test Connection”测试连接是否成功,成功后点击“OK”保存连接。
4. 使用MySQL Workbench:
选择刚刚创建的连接,点击“Open Connection”按钮,即可进入MySQL Workbench的主界面,进行数据库的管理和操作。

四、常见问题及解决方法

在使用MySQL数据库的过程中,你可能会遇到一些常见的问题。 下面列举几个常见问题及其解决方法:


1. 忘记MySQL root密码怎么办?

如果你忘记了MySQL的root密码,可以通过以下步骤重置:


1. 停止MySQL服务:
使用以下命令停止MySQL服务:
net stop mysql


2. 跳过权限表启动MySQL:
使用以下命令启动MySQL,跳过权限表:
mysqld --skip-grant-tables


3. 登录MySQL:
使用以下命令登录MySQL,无需密码:
mysql -u root


4. 修改root密码:
在MySQL命令行中,使用以下命令修改root密码:
FLUSH PRIVILEGES;
SET PASSWORD FOR 'root'@'localhost' = PASSWORD('new_password');

new_password替换为你想要设置的新密码。


5. 重启MySQL服务:
使用以下命令重启MySQL服务:
net start mysql

更多相关百科常识